Introduction to Ironwood

Ironwood trees are found in different parts of the world, with various species exhibiting similar characteristics of hardness and density. The most common species include the American ironwood (Ostrya virginiana), the Australian ironwood (Eucalyptus tetragona), and the African ironwood (Lovoa trichilioides). These trees are not only renowned for their wood but also for their ecological importance, providing habitat and food for a variety of wildlife.

Physical Properties of Ironwood

The wood of ironwood trees is exceptionally hard and dense, with a Janka hardness rating that surpasses many other types of wood. This hardness, combined with its density, makes ironwood highly resistant to wear and tear, rot, and insect damage. The color of ironwood can vary from a deep brown to almost black, depending on the species, and it often features a straight grain, which adds to its aesthetic appeal.

Construction and Furniture Making

Due to its durability and resistance to decay, ironwood is highly prized for construction and furniture making. It is used for creating heavy-duty flooring, beams, and posts, as well as for making outdoor furniture that can withstand harsh weather conditions. The density of ironwood also makes it an excellent choice for woodturning, allowing craftsmen to create intricate and durable items such as bowls and vases.

Challenges and Considerations

While ironwood offers many benefits, there are also challenges associated with its use. The high cost of ironwood due to its rarity and the difficulty of working with it can make it less accessible for some projects. Additionally, the sustainability of ironwood harvesting is a concern, as over-harvesting can threaten the long-term viability of ironwood populations. It is essential to source ironwood from sustainably managed forests to ensure that its use does not harm the environment.
